Eurovision producers are apparently keen to get the 'Blame It On The Girls' singer to pen the track to avoid a repeat of this year's competition, in which the UK came last.
A BBC source told The Sun: "It's always a difficult call trying to get a decent song together for Eurovision, as this year proved. We had Pete Waterman overseeing it but we still came last.
"Mika has all the right ingredients to make a successful song. We hope he says yes."
